Description
A statistic model is developed for the description of the breakup process of excited heavy nuclei. All possible processes determining the state of nuclear matter at excitation energies approximately 10 MeV/nucleon are investigated in detail. Dynamic effects determining excitation parameters of the nuclear system appearing during collision of heavy ions are considered. A simple analytical model for the calculation of mass distributions of flying-out fragments and their multiplicity is suggested. The model demonstrates that multifragmentation (''complete explosion'') of colliding nuclei takes place in cases of not very low initial energies and more central collisions. The important role of effects of incomplete statistic equilibrium is noted
